Detailed Description
Specific objectives of this study are the evaluation of:
- The social, cultural and behavioral factors that impact the uptake of the NCD control services among rural women using the Rapid Assessment, Response and Evaluation (RARE) approach;
The feasibility and acceptability of the strategy to deliver the following NCD control services to the rural women at their homes by the trained CHWs:
- Counselling of the tobacco habitués to give up the practice
- Early detection of hypertension and diabetes to ensure prompt and regular treatment
- Creating breast awareness and ensuring access to prompt diagnosis and treatment of the women with symptoms suggestive of breast cancer
- Screening for cervical cancer by self-collected HPV test and ensuring prompt treatment of screen detected precancers and cancers
- Screening of the habitual tobacco/alcohol users for oral cancer by OVE and ensuring prompt treatment of screen detected precancers and cancers

Inclusion Criteria:
- Women between 30 to 60 years residing in the villages of the Gogunda block in the district of Udaipur in Rajasthan, India, will be eligible to participate.
Exclusion Criteria:
- Women suffering from debilitating illnesses, pregnant women and women refusing to participate will be excluded.
